If you have the ability to pump behind the liner then get that bitch pumping. Doesn't matter what it looks like at this point you've got to get the water out and can deal with any wrinkles later
Posted on 3/11/16 at 9:14 am to Tiger4Ever
I have a lot of experience with this. Unfortunately, it's all bad. Yes, the liner will settle but chances are high that some wrinkles will still be there and they're almost impossible to get out. I pump from behind the liner religiously after heavy rains but I waited about an hour too long yesterday. Pumped water out all night but it's too late. I have a few huge wrinkles that aren't coming out. I've tried everything in the past. I absolutely hate seeing my pool like that. Drives me crazy.
